They&#8217;re great games.<\/p>\n <p>The first day was spent a little on a different idea (that wasn&#8217;t anywhere near as good), and then on getting the main mechanic working. I spent far too long going about it a different way, but eventually settled on the way it works now.<\/p>\n <p>Second day was almost 100% bugfixes and small tweaks, There&#8217;s a good number of problems that arise with a system like this, and yeah, not all of the issues were solved. Determining when to use which dimension&#8217;s physics is harder than it might seem, as well as managing the multiple layers and culling masks to make raycasting work well. Animation issues, camera issues, and a few issues with puzzles.
